Becarre, BemolLiterature1: Sauter de bécarre en bémol (French), to jump from one subject to another without regard to pertinence; "Sauter du coq à l'ane," from Genesis to Revelation. Literally, to jump from sharps to flats. Becarre is the Latin B quadratum or B quarré. In old musical notation B sharp was expressed by a square B, and B flat by a round B.
2: Bémol is B mollis, soft (flat). Source: Brewer's Dictionary.
